package jmri.jmrix.ipocs.protocol.packets;
import static org.junit.Assert.assertArrayEquals;
import static org.junit.jupiter.api.Assertions.assertEquals;
import java.nio.ByteBuffer;
import jmri.jmrix.ipocs.protocol.enums.RqAlarmState;
import jmri.util.JUnitUtil;
import org.junit.jupiter.api.*;
public class AlarmPacketTest {
private final byte[] testPacket = { 0x01, 0x23, 0x45, RqAlarmState.Transient.value, 0x00, 0x00, 0x00, 0x01, 0x00, 0x00, 0x00, 0x02 };
@Test
public void getIdTest() {
assertEquals(AlarmPacket.IDENT, new AlarmPacket().getId());
}
@Test
public void parseSpecificTest() {
AlarmPacket pkt = new AlarmPacket();
pkt.parseSpecific(ByteBuffer.wrap(testPacket));
assertEquals(0x0123, pkt.getAlarmCode());
assertEquals(0x45, pkt.getAlarmLevel());
assertEquals(RqAlarmState.Transient, pkt.getAlarmState());
assertEquals(1, pkt.getParameter1());
assertEquals(2, pkt.getParameter2());
}
@Test
public void serializeSpecificTest() {
AlarmPacket pkt = new AlarmPacket();
pkt.setAlarmCode((short)0x0123);
pkt.setAlarmLevel((byte)0x45);
pkt.setAlarmState(RqAlarmState.Transient);
pkt.setParameter1(1);
pkt.setParameter2(2);
assertArrayEquals(testPacket, pkt.serializeSpecific());
}
@BeforeEach
public void setUp() {
JUnitUtil.setUp();
}
@AfterEach
public void tearDown() {
JUnitUtil.tearDown();
}
}
